Seemingly all it references is if the hole is over 50% in width, then I need a galvanized metal tie on the side (both … WebApr 3, 2024 · No notches in the middle 1/3 of the joist, but holes are permitted here. No notches deeper than 1/6 the joist depth. No end notches (where the joist is supported) greater than 1/4 the joist depth. The length of a notch should not exceed 1/3 the joist depth. Do not make square or rectangular cutouts. Also avoid square cuts in notches — angled ...

Any stud in an exterior wall or bearing partition may be cut or notched to a depth not exceeding 25 percent of its width. Studs in nonbearing partitions may be notched to a depth not to exceed 40 percent of a single stud width.
